Pure Nonfiction partnered with The Ankler for a live event in Los Angeles that highlighted documentary projects eligible for this year’s Emmys. On this episode, host Thom Powers interviews the teams behind five different episodic series: - Andrew Jarecki on The Jinx - Part Two - Prentice Penny on Black Twitter: A People’s History - Sam Lipman-Stern and Adam Bhala Lough on Telemarketers - Jasha Klebe on Our Planet II - Fisher Stevens on Beckham Whether or not you’ve seen these projects, the interviews bring insight into a wide variety of filmmaking styles.
